Understanding the Tax Return Process in Australia
Each year, individuals in Australia are required to lodge a tax return to report their income and determine if they owe tax or if they are entitled to a refund. The Australian tax system works on a financial year that runs from July 1 to June 30, and tax returns are typically due by October 31 for those who handle their taxes independently. However, using a tax agent offers several advantages, including extended deadlines and expert guidance to ensure you’re maximizing your refund.

On-the-Spot Tax Refunds: What You Need to Know
An on-the-spot tax refund means that your refund is processed immediately upon the lodgment of your tax return. This could be a great way to get your money back quickly. However, the specifics of how this works depend on your circumstances and the tax agent you’re working with.
Here’s how the process generally works:
● Preparation: You provide your tax agent with all the necessary documents, such as income statements, receipts for deductions, and any other required paperwork.
● Lodgement: The tax agent files your tax return with the Australian Taxation Office (ATO) using their secure system. In many cases, the ATO processes returns very quickly.

● Refund Processing: If your return is straightforward and you’re entitled to a refund, the ATO may process your refund immediately, sometimes on the same day of lodgment. For more complex returns, the processing time may be longer, but many tax agents offer expedited services for quicker results.
Important to note: Not everyone will qualify for an immediate refund. If you have a more complicated tax situation, such as business income or multiple sources of income, it may take longer for the ATO to finalize your return and process any refund.
Tips for Ensuring a Smooth Tax Return Process in 2025
If you’re considering lodging your tax return in 2025, here are some tips to ensure everything goes smoothly:
● Get Organized Early: Gather all necessary documents early, such as your income statements, receipts, and any other paperwork related to deductions.
● Keep Track of Deductions: If you are entitled to claim deductions (e.g., work-related expenses), make sure you keep accurate records throughout the year.

● Double Check Your Personal Information: Ensure that your personal details, including your bank account information, are up to date with the ATO to avoid delays.
● Be Honest About Your Finances: Make sure all income is reported accurately. The ATO has sophisticated systems for matching income data, and failing to report income can lead to penalties.
